Jiangsu Longda Superalloy


Founded in 2004, Jiangsu Longda Superalloy Co., Ltd. (hereinafter referred to as the Company) is devoted to building a world-class superalloy R&D and manufacturing base. It is an exemplary business of the “One-Stop” Application Program for High-Temperature Resistant Blades of Aero-Engines and Gas Turbines under China’s Industrial Foundation Enhancement Project, as well as a state-level specialized, sophisticated, distinctive, and innovative “Little Giant” enterprise. The Company was successfully listed on the Science and Technology Innovation Board of the Shanghai Stock Exchange on July 22, 2022 (Stock Code: SH688231).

By upholding the corporate motto of “Science &Technology as Primary Productive Forces, Talents as Primary Resource”, the Company focuses on high-tech manufacturing. It has established a Superalloy Technology Research Institute, a Jiangsu Provincial Academician Workstation, and a Postdoctoral Innovation Practice Base. Besides that, the Company has been recognized as the Jiangsu Provincial Engineering Technology Research Center for Superalloy and the Jiangsu Provincial Engineering Research Center for Superalloy. Besides that, the Company’s technical team has been selected into Jiangsu Province’s Innovation & Entrepreneurship Program as innovation & entrepreneurship team, talents, and doctors, as well as Wuxi City’s “Taihu Lake Talent Program” as a leading team.

Jiangsu Longda Superalloy Aerospace Materials Co., Ltd.


Jiangsu Longda Superalloy Aerospace Materials Co., Ltd. was established in 2015 and is a wholly-owned subsidiary of Jiangsu Longda Superalloy Co., Ltd. The company specializes in the research, development, and manufacturing of cast high-temperature alloys and wrought high-temperature alloys—key materials for aerospace engines. Its flagship products include cast high-temperature alloy materials for engine blades and wrought high-temperature alloy materials for engine turbine disks. The company is a demonstration enterprise under the national “One-Stop” application program for high-temperature-resistant blades used in aerospace engines and gas turbines, as part of the National Industrial Foundation Strengthening Project, and also a nationally recognized “Specialized, Refined, Differentiated, and Innovative” Small Giant Enterprise. The company has obtained certifications including the AS9100 international aerospace quality management system, environmental management system, occupational health and safety management system, CNAS national laboratory accreditation, and NADCAP international laboratory accreditation.

The company boasts world-class production equipment and laboratories, with an annual production capacity of 3,000 tons of cast high-temperature alloys and 5,000 tons of wrought high-temperature alloys. It has achieved breakthroughs in ultra-high-purity vacuum melting technologies for master alloys of single-crystal, equiaxed, and directionally solidified high-temperature alloys, reaching internationally advanced levels. The company has developed and manufactured advanced single-crystal high-temperature alloys for aero-engine turbine blades, which are now being used in Chinese commercial aero-engines, replacing imported products and meeting international airworthiness standards. Products such as equiaxed, directionally solidified, and single-crystal cast high-temperature alloys have already been applied to core components of aero-engines. The company’s application of ultra-high-purity technologies has been thoroughly validated and widely promoted, establishing engineered production capabilities and raising the standards and quality of the high-temperature alloy industry.

The transformed high-temperature alloy has broken through the “positive triple-link” manufacturing technology used for turbine disks in aero-engines. The resulting products have already been applied to core components such as aero-engine and gas-turbine turbine disks and casings, with the goal of achieving independent supply and replacing imports.

Cast high-temperature alloy products have been exported in bulk for use in foreign gas turbines. The “Zheng San Lian” deformed high-temperature alloy has already been supplied to international aeroengine manufacturers such as Rolls-Royce, GE, and Collins Aerospace.

The company has undertaken several key national research projects focused on materials.
